Kazakhstan’s Tax Policy Shift: Understanding the Market Catalyst

In July 2024, Kazakhstan implemented a significant restructuring of its mineral extraction tax (MET) framework for uranium operations. The move replaced the previous 6% flat rate with a tiered system—9% in 2025 and potentially up to 20.5% in 2026. According to analysis from major financial institutions, this tax increase creates a disincentive for production expansion, suggesting that suppliers may prioritize profit margins over volume growth. The outcome: supply constraints could intensify even as demand accelerates, supporting uranium price appreciation. This backdrop has made uranium ETFs particularly compelling for investors seeking systematic exposure to both mining operations and nuclear energy infrastructure.

Sizing Up the Players: Asset Base and Market Reach

The three leading uranium ETFs differ substantially in scale and strategic positioning. The Global X Uranium ETF (URA) commands the largest presence with $3.58 billion in assets under management, tracking the Solactive Global Uranium & Nuclear Components Total Return Index. This broad mandate captures the entire uranium ecosystem—from extraction and exploration to nuclear component manufacturing.

In contrast, the VanEck Uranium & Nuclear Energy ETF (NLR) manages $241 million in assets and follows the MVIS Global Uranium & Nuclear Energy Index, casting a wider net that includes nuclear utility operators alongside uranium specialists. The Sprott Uranium Miners ETF (URNM) occupies the middle ground with $1.71 billion in AUM, maintaining a laser-focused strategy concentrated in the North Shore Global Uranium Mining Index, which emphasizes pure-play uranium mining operations and physical uranium holdings.

This variation in asset base reflects different investor profiles: URA attracts broad-based interest, URNM appeals to those seeking concentrated uranium mining exposure, and NLR serves investors comfortable with utility company holdings.

Geographic and Sector Exposure: Diversification Strategies

Beyond size, these uranium ETFs pursue distinctly different geographic and sectoral approaches. URA offers exposure across uranium miners like Cameco (25.16% of holdings), Kazatomprom, and exploration companies such as NexGen Energy and Uranium Energy, alongside physical uranium trusts. The fund’s composition reflects the global mining landscape, concentrating risk among established producers while maintaining exposure to development-stage companies.

NLR takes a notably broader tack, incorporating North American utilities alongside traditional uranium players. With 39.5% invested in U.S. energy companies—including Constellation Energy and Public Service Enterprise Group—plus 17.1% in Canada and exposure to European and Asian operators like Fortum Oyj, NLR blends traditional nuclear utility upside with uranium commodity appreciation. This hybrid approach appeals to investors seeking both operational cash flow stability and commodity upside.

URNM maintains the most specialized positioning, with holdings concentrated among pure uranium miners: Cameco (17.10%), Kazatomprom (14%), and specialized operators like Denison Mines and CGN Mining. This focused strategy eliminates utility exposure, directing capital entirely toward companies whose fortunes rise and fall with uranium prices and production.

Liquidity and Accessibility: Trading Considerations

Liquidity varies meaningfully across these three uranium ETFs. URA dominates with average daily trading volume near 2.5 million shares, enabling investors to enter and exit positions without significant price impact—a crucial advantage for institutional investors and those implementing systematic strategies. URNM follows with approximately 400,000 shares in daily volume, maintaining reasonable tradability despite its smaller asset base.

NLR presents a material liquidity constraint, averaging fewer than 100,000 shares daily. Investors considering NLR should account for wider bid-ask spreads, which could increase transaction costs during entry and exit, particularly for larger position sizes.

Cost Structure: Expense Ratios and Fee Comparison

Fee efficiency separates these funds across a narrow band. NLR offers the most competitive expense ratio at 0.60% (net), making it the lowest-cost option for uranium and nuclear energy exposure. URA charges 0.69%, while URNM—despite its concentrated strategy—costs 0.85% annually. The differences appear modest in absolute terms, but for buy-and-hold investors, these variations compound significantly over decades. For investors planning 10-year holdings, the cumulative impact of fee differential alone could exceed 1.5-2% of returns.

Income Generation: Dividend Yields in Perspective

All three uranium ETFs distribute regular dividends, though at varying rates reflecting their underlying holdings and cash flow characteristics. URA leads with a 5.56% yield, paying $1.71 annualized per share across two distributions yearly. URNM provides 3.4% ($1.75 per share annually), while NLR offers 3.89%. The higher URA yield partially reflects its physical uranium trust holdings (Sprott Physical Uranium Trust represents nearly 8% of the fund), which typically generate elevated distributions.

Income-focused investors may gravitate toward URA for its yield advantage, though it’s crucial to distinguish between investment returns and income—yield alone shouldn’t drive ETF selection without consideration of capital appreciation potential.

Performance Review: Historical Returns and Market Context

Historical performance data from the original fund launch through mid-2024 reveals that all three uranium ETFs benefited from the commodity rally and nuclear energy enthusiasm. URA posted 33.2% returns over its preceding 12-month period, with year-to-date gains reaching 5.2% at the time of the original analysis. NLR delivered 33.8% over 52 weeks and 12.6% year-to-date, while URNM contributed 41.8% over the prior year despite showing slightly negative year-to-date performance at that juncture.

These historical figures should be evaluated within their proper context: data from 2024 reflects a specific market phase dominated by nuclear energy enthusiasm and uranium commodity strength. Investors should not extrapolate these historical returns into forward projections, but rather recognize them as documentation of past market conditions.

Selecting the Right Uranium ETF: A Decision Framework

Choosing among these uranium ETFs depends on individual investment objectives and constraints. Liquidity-focused traders should prioritize URA given its deep market depth. Income-seeking investors may favor URA for its 5.56% yield, accepting slightly higher fees for the income generation. Cost-conscious long-term holders should consider NLR despite its limited daily volume, given the 0.60% net expense ratio advantage over 10-20 year horizons. Uranium mining specialists seeking maximum leverage to uranium prices and mining operations should consider URNM’s concentrated approach, accepting the trade-off of limited geographic and sectoral diversification.
